In the heart of Cairo, Four Seasons Hotel Cairo at
The First Residence encompasses dramatic views
of the Nile River, the Great Pyramids and the
Zoological Garden. The hotel offers 269 rooms and
43 suites, which are among the city’s most spacious
and lavish. Ideally situated in the prestigious First
Place Complex, business and leisure travelers can
enjoy exclusive shopping and a world-class casino.
The hotel’s Spa and Wellness Centre offers an
array of therapeutic massages and body and facial
treatments. Truly this hotel is a destination in itself.

Measles is a highly contagious disease of the upper respiratory tract accompanied by fever and a characteristic reddish rash that spreads over the entire body. The name of the disease dates back to fourteenthcentury English and means “spot.”  Measles rash on the face of a  patient

Alzheimer Disease Alzheimer disease, or AD, is a terminal disease of the central nervous system that has no effective treatment or cure. Its most notable symptom is dementia beyond the effects of normal aging.
